What are the essential steps to build a successful freelance portfolio that showcases my range of skills and experiences to potential clients?

**Cognitive Biases in Portfolio Review**: Be aware of biases like confirmation bias and the halo effect when reviewing your portfolio, as they can influence your perception of your own work.
**The Dunning-Kruger Effect**: Be humble and recognize your limitations when creating your portfolio, as overconfidence can lead to poor quality work.
**Visual Hierarchy**: Organize your portfolio using visual hierarchy principles to guide the viewer's attention and create a clear narrative flow.
**The Science of Attention**: Use attention-grabbing elements like GIFs, callouts, and screenshots to break up text and increase engagement.
**The Role of Emotional Connection**: Create an emotional connection with your audience by showcasing your personality and values through your portfolio.
**The 5-Second Rule**: Ensure your portfolio can be quickly scanned and understood within 5 seconds to capture the viewer's attention.
**The Fragmented Attention Span**: Break up large chunks of text into smaller, easily digestible sections to cater to the short attention span of modern viewers.
**The Importance of Context**: Provide context for each piece of work in your portfolio, including the problem you solved, your role, and the outcome.
**The Role of Self-Reflection**: Regularly review and refine your portfolio to reflect your growth and development as a professional.
**The Power of Consistency**: Establish a consistent tone, style, and format throughout your portfolio to create a cohesive narrative.
